Aside from being a celebrated interior designer and photographer, Vicente Wolf is also an adventurous world traveler. In fact, it’s his passion for travel that informs and inspires much of his design work which reflects his global sensibility. Vicente enjoys immersing himself in other cultures and his travels have taken him to such far flung places as Ethiopia, Thailand, India, Peru, Myanmar, New Guinea, Namibia and the list goes on. Earlier in the summer I had my best friend and her husband over for a visit and I made them this very decadent, very yummy coconut cake. I garnished it with freshly shaven coconut and let me tell you, this cake was insanity! Here’s the recipe:

Double Layer Coconut Cake

Adapted from Sweets: Soul Food Desserts & Menus by Betty Piner

2 sticks (one cup) of unsalted butter, softened

2 cups sugar

4 eggs separated

3 cups sifted cake flower (I prefer Swan’s Down)

2 teaspoons baking powder

1/4 teaspoon salt

1 cup whole milk
